entropy.plugin computes the Shannon entropy H
of a discrete random variable from the specified bin frequencies.
entropy.plugin(freqs, unit=c("log", "log2", "log10"))
freqs |
bin frequencies. |
unit |
the unit in which entropy is measured.
The default is "nats" (natural units). For
computing entropy in "bits" set |
The Shannon entropy of a discrete random variable is defined as H = -∑ p(x_i) \log( p(x_i) ), where p(x_i) are the bin probabilities.
entropy.plugin returns the Shannon entropy.

# load entropy library
library("entropy")
# some frequencies
freqs = c(0.2, 0.1, 0.15, 0.05, 0, 0.3, 0.2)
# and corresponding entropy
entropy.plugin(freqs)
